But not Christopher Nolan, the toast of the mortal world\u2019s Mount Olympus \u2014 Hollywood.<\/p>\n<p>Read more <a href=\"https:\/\/relocationobserver.com\/?p=4646\">Jennifer Garner and Judy Greer to Appear in Netflix\u2019s \u201913 Going on 30\u2032 Reboot<\/a><\/p>\n<p>\n\tThe opening-weekend success of his Imax epic \u201cThe Odyssey\u201d cements Nolan as his own kind of myth: a bankable auteur who can command the attention of worldwide moviegoers simply by picking up his camera.<\/p>\n<p>Nolan has spent most of his career in the upper stratosphere of show business; he\u2019s thought to be one of a few name directors who are events unto themselves (Quentin Tarantino, Ryan Coogler, Greta Gerwig, James Cameron). But after a nearly $265 million global first frame for \u201cThe Odyssey,\u201d the best start of Nolan\u2019s career, he\u2019s moved even closer to the sun. Analysts predict the film now has the runway to gross $1 billion around the world. The title has also crashed down on this year\u2019s Oscars race like a thunderbolt from Zeus, disrupting a low-hum narrative that Amazon MGM\u2019s \u201cProject Hail Mary\u201d is the reigning, populist choice for best picture.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e Odyssey\u201d has \u201cinvited people back to a theatrical experience which had been hobbled since the pandemic,\u201d says Jason E. Squire, professor emeritus at USC School of Cinematic Arts. \u201cThis is an extraordinary creative and commercial victory for Nolan and Universal Pictures.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Indeed, the other victor here is Donna Langley, NBCUniversal\u2019s entertainment and studios chairman. As the days tick by and box office records for \u201cThe Odyssey\u201d keep rolling in, it\u2019s abundantly clear how important it was that Langley wooed Nolan to Universal Pictures five years ago following his messy breakup with Warner Bros.<\/p>\n<p>In 2021, Langley fended off Sony Pictures, Paramount and the deep-pocketed Apple Studios to win the director\u2019s unexpected blockbuster \u201cOppenheimer.\u201d While Nolan never has signed any kind of exclusive studio deal \u2014 and almost surely never will \u2014 Langley\u2019s team has proven an able partner for the once-in-a-generation talent. In essence, they have replaced Warner Bros., where Nolan made nine of his 13 movies, as his default home.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cYou may think it\u2019s an easy approval process to move forward with any Nolan movie, but it\u2019s an enormous financial commitment. A $250 million budget, another $100 million at least for marketing? There is no guarantee of profitability, and that\u2019s the intriguing and seductive gamble for movie executives,\u201d added Squire, who taught Coogler at USC and hosts \u201cThe Movie Business Podcast.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>That gamble has paid off and observably came down to an issue of trust. Nolan was incensed in 2021 when Warner Bros., his studio partner of nearly 20 years, went rogue amid the COVID-19 pandemic and decided to release a full slate of films concurrently on its streaming service HBO Max and in cineplexes. This directly impacted Nolan\u2019s time-traveling action film \u201cTenet,\u201d led by John David Washington and Robert Pattinson. Nolan\u2019s brand exclusively celebrates movies made for theaters. Jason Kilar, the corporate overlord of Warners at the time, exploded the company\u2019s goodwill with talent and agents in every corner of the business by forcing the studio\u2019s titles to stream day and date.<\/p>\n<p>Langley, known for an English sort of grace under pressure and her bedside manner with filmmakers, swooped in with a complex and unusual deal for \u201cOppenheimer.\u201d It guaranteed a lengthy exclusive theatrical window for the opus about the atomic bomb, committed in writing to a marketing spend equal to the film\u2019s $100 million budget <em>and<\/em> awarded Nolan a generous portion of the film\u2019s first-dollar box office grosses. Nolan earned a reported $100 million in fees and back end for the best picture Oscar winner. Langley and Nolan\u2019s bond had been forged years before, as the two both have same-aged kids. <\/p>\n<p>While his \u201cOdyssey\u201d deal is thought to be a more standard agreement than the \u201cOppenheimer\u201d pact, insiders say Nolan will again receive first-dollar gross. That means he stands to reap millions for his work on top of his salary early in \u201cThe Odyssey\u201d\u2019s theatrical run, instead of having to wait until the film is profitable. Reps for Universal Pictures and Nolan declined to comment.<\/p>\n<p>Not that WB, Universal\u2019s neighbor in Burbank, didn\u2019t put up a fight. In 2022, following Discovery\u2019s purchase of Warner Bros., the film studio\u2019s incoming leaders, Mike De Luca and Pamela Abdy, announced plainly in a <em>Variety<\/em> cover story that they were \u201choping\u201d to get Nolan back. Subsequently, we reported that De Luca and Abdy cut a seven-figure check to the director in 2022 \u2014 a payment in arrears for fees he waived in hopes of getting \u201cTenet\u201d to be the first film shown in theaters reopening after coronavirus closures.<\/p>\n<p>That \u201clittle kiss,\u201d as one source put it, didn\u2019t work. Especially given the windfall that came to Nolan after Warner Bros. staked its own blockbuster \u201cBarbie\u201d on the same July 2023 release date that Universal had given \u201cOppenheimer.\u201d While the competition ignited the box office in a world-class example of counterprogramming, the move was seen as baiting and antagonizing the director. <\/p>\n<p>And so Universal won the day again with \u201cThe Odyssey.\u201d After the success of \u201cOppenheimer,\u201d Nolan and partner Emma Thomas did not take \u201cThe Odyssey\u201d out to other bidders. Langley traveled to Nolan and Thomas\u2019 Hollywood Hills home and read the script with the pair, insiders say. Afterward, the group rolled directly into planning for the Matt Damon epic.<\/p>\n<p>Nolan can run the table with any studio partner he wants, but \u201cThe Odyssey\u201d feels like his own homecoming to Langley\u2019s lot. Shareholders, the creative community and global audiences are all pleased. Why test the movie gods?<\/p>\n<p>Read more <a href=\"https:\/\/relocationobserver.com\/?p=4644\">Sony Music Files Another Lawsuit Against Udio, Alleges AI Music Generator Copied 30,000 Songs to Train Models<\/a><\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>With the smash opening of &#8220;The Odyssey,&#8221; Christopher Nolan becomes the most powerful director in town.
